Did this see service in WW 2?

It did not serve in WW II, only Suez and Korea. It looks superbe anyway!!

Anybody getting the Dutch one???

The Dutch one is excellent. The dark sea grey going to the bottom line of the fuselage makes this really stand out. The only dissapointment is the lack of detailing (colour) on the rockets, but that's being really picky. Here are some photos.
